- [ ] Step 7: Archive cold storage buckets (Glacierline tier). Confirm both ceremony witnesses are present, verify bucket manifests match the Oxbow ledger, then seal the archive key shares. Plugin authors may observe but not handle shares. Once sealed, the archive index itself is encrypted and can only be reopened with the passphrase below.

vault phrase of badup-hahig = tamael-aldael-kelmir-istael-fenok-istwyn-tamius-jorath-oliion

Offline mode for TerraCount field surveys: sync queue persists to local store; flush on reconnect. Do not clear the cache dir mid-survey or queued plots are lost. Restart the agent after config edits. Offline sync requires the device enrollment token in the env file; add it on the next line.

vault entry, yahif-yajep: COURIER_KEY29=b802bdf8034096b65a51c6ba5abe2

Ticket: Expired credential blocking Stockhopper restock planner

The Stockhopper vending-machine restock planner stopped syncing route data last night because its credential for the internal Cartwheel inventory service expired. Scheduled restock runs for the Bramblegate depot are queued but not executing. A replacement credential has been issued with the same scopes; the release manager should push it with tonight's config deploy. The new key for the planner is below.

service key, tadup-tahog: zpat7_wB1tnEL

## Step 4: Swap in the new image cache

Quick heads-up before you migrate: the old Snapwell cache leaked memory because evicted thumbnails kept live references in the preview pane. The replacement fixes that, but you must set explicit eviction limits or it falls back to the leaky unbounded mode. Set these before restarting the worker. The values we run everywhere now are:

service settings:
[casax]
port = 6379
team = rusir
host = casax.zemvarhq.corp
region = outer-4
access_code = ac_9808ce
timeout_ms = 1500

Title: Deep links to shared folders open the wrong tab on Android

In the Cartwheel mobile app, tapping a shared-folder deep link lands on the Recents tab instead of Shared. The router in NavGraphResolver matches the path prefix greedily, so /shared/* falls through to the default route. Reproduces consistently on the Pinefield test devices. The first build exhibiting the regression is noted below.

trace token, fafog-kageg: htk4_98e6